Abstract <p>Chemically induced dynamic nuclear polarization and laser flash photolysis are used to study the formation and photodegradation of deferiprone chelate complexes with calcium and zinc ions. Deferiprone in the complexes degrades rapidly under the action of ultraviolet radiation. Radical intermediates of deferiprone are registered, and the quantum yield of its photodegradation in a complex with zinc grows by 6.4&#xa0;times.</p>
